Potato Chips: export from Canada to ASEAN
Potato chips are high-volume and low-density, which makes freight a large share of landed cost and pushes the economics toward premium positioning rather than mainstream price points. A buyer modelling a mass-market price against local manufacture should run that arithmetic before anything else.
The technical variables are the frying oil and its oxidative stability, the seasoning system, the packaging barrier and whether the pack is nitrogen flushed. Shelf life in a warm humid market is shorter than the Canadian specification implies, and rancidity rather than staleness is usually the end point.
Flavour localisation is the commercial variable that decides repeat purchase. Canadian seasoning profiles do not always transfer, and a producer willing to run a destination-specific seasoning at export volumes has a real advantage over one shipping the domestic range.
Breakage in transit is worth specifying tolerance for.
Prepared potato products classify under their own line, distinct from both fresh and frozen potatoes. Confirm the position for the finished snack rather than reasoning from the raw material.

MFN duty is the destination's applied general rate for this tariff line. Preferential is the rate under an agreement in force between Canada and that market. Both are customs duty only: destination excise, value-added tax and local levies are additional and are not shown here.
